Grand Theft Auto V is getting a next-gen console update for
PlayStation 5 and
Xbox Series X|S.
GTA Online is also getting a standalone release. On top of that
Kerbal Space Program is getting enhanced alongside "three unannounced" remasters.
This comes via a new
financial heavy presentation from Take-Two which breaks down the games coming this financial year from the company.
'Immersive Core' games, these being the big hitters, are listed as NBA 2K22, WWE 2k22, Tiny Tina's Wonderlands, and one unannounced 2K joint from Gearbox.
'Independent' lists
OlliOllie World from Private Division.
There's also 10 'mobile' games, and the six remasters covered above.
